KARACHI, Pakistan: Pakistan’s national bank has cut its forecast for the country’s economic growth this fiscal year to 6.0-6.5 percent.
The State Bank of Pakistan said Monday it was revising its forecast for the year ending June 30 in the light of “domestic turbulence and external shocks.”
